When Malory suspects that she might have breast cancer, she undergoes a medical examination — but ends up whining over not being the center of attention when Archer is the one who has breast cancer.

  • Bait-and-Switch:
    • At the end, Archer gets a call post-surgery that it was successful and he is now cancer-free, only to get another call to say that's not the case, only to get another call to say it was the case, only to get one more call to confirm once and for all that he still has cancer.
  • Bullying a Dragon: Brett decides it's a good idea to mock Archer, a lethally dangerous spy and certified badass, for having cancer. He learns why that's a bad idea when he proceeds to get the shit beat out of him by a rightfully pissed off Archer.
  • Cannot Keep a Secret: Very common for Pam throughout the series, but this shows one of the worst examples, as she is still actively texting the ISIS staff about Malory's diagnosis when told to keep it confidential.
    • A suspicious Archer immediately goads Pam into spilling the beans with minimal effort, exploiting this trope.
  • Dude, Not Funny!: Archer beats up Brett (intentionally with his bare hands for once) after the latter mocked the former for having breast cancer. Nobody even tries to stop him, seemingly from the same reaction.
  • Freeze-Frame Bonus: In the hospital waiting room, Malory reads a magazine for restaurant servers called "Waiting", and Lana reads a design magazine called "Rooms".
  • It's All About Me: Malory is accused of this when it turns out that Archer has cancer and not her.
  • Laser-Guided Karma: Immediately after Brett mocks Archer's cancer, the latter tackles the former and proceeds to beat him up pretty badly. Further, nobody else even pretends to make any sort of effort to stop him, evidently believing Brett earned it.
